Step 1: Add all ingredients to a mixing bowl

Place the creamy no-stir peanut butter, honey, vanilla protein powder, old fashioned rolled oats, mini chocolate chips, and mini M&M’s into a large mixing bowl. Step 2: Fold and mix into a thick, sticky batter

Using a rubber spatula, fold the wet ingredients into the dry until a thick, tacky batter forms that pulls away from the bowl but still clings slightly to the spatula. Work patiently until the mixture is uniform and dense enough to hold a scooped shape—this is the true visual milestone for the recipe.


Step 3: Prepare a lined tray for shaping

Line a cookie sheet with a single sheet of wax paper so the balls won’t stick; place a mini cookie scoop and a small saucer nearby for quick access. The lined surface should be clean and minimal, emphasizing the ready-to-fill staging area where the scooped portions will land.

Step 4: Portion the mixture onto the sheet

Scoop the batter by mini cookie scoop or spoonfuls and drop neat rounds onto the wax paper, spaced evenly. Step 5: Smooth and roll each ball

Gently roll each dropped mound between your palms to smooth seams and create tight, round energy bites with rustic oat texture peeking through. Step 6: Chill until firm

Arrange the rolled balls on the lined tray and chill in the refrigerator until firm—about an hour—so the binder sets and the balls feel cohesive and slightly springy when pressed. The chilled texture becomes more compact and less sticky, with oats and chocolate clearly embedded and the candies holding their shape.

Step 7: Store the finished energy bites

Transfer the chilled Monster Cookie Protein Balls into an airtight container for refrigeration or freezing; the bites remain dense, chewy, and colorful.
